Jesus said to him, "You have answered right; do this, and you will live." Gal 5:17 – Lusts against (epiqumei kata ). This use of sarx as opposed (Like a tug of war) to the Spirit (Holy Spirit) is not evil as we think of it but evil as God sees it. The flesh is simply the physical, which is the created as opposed to the creator. Mankind tends to trust in the temporary and not live by the Spirit or in the Spirit – which is God. epiqumei is the verb, epiqumia , the noun , which does not mean evil desire, but simply to long after with controling urge. ( allhloij antikeitai ) of man’s affections through a devotion to the temporary or its creator. They are lined up in conflict, face to face, a spiritual duel (cf. Christ's temptations). So that you may be kept from doing. ( i`na mh poihte ) Whatever you wishWe are being called to seeing our lives as full in Christ.
